About the role:
We are looking for an enthusiastic Social Worker to be a part of the multidisciplinary health care team, providing high-quality care to patients/ clients of the Murrumbidgee Local Health District in order to support management of their health needs and to promote wellness.
As the Social Worker, you will be responsible for:
- Providing comprehensive Social Worker service across a range of clinical areas and settings.
- Providing a consultative service in area/s of clinical expertise to clinicians across the district to promote the consistent provision of safe high quality patient centred care.
- Evaluating treatment according to patient/client goal achievement in collaboration with senior clinicians as appropriate, with alterations to intervention/plans made accordingly.
- Collaborating within a multidisciplinary team to optimise the health care and wellbeing of each client and their loved ones.
- Lead, complete and share in continuous improvement initiatives, to enhance service delivery and client/patient/consumer outcomes, and participation in clinical research activities as required
